clipboard物件
是windows中的剪貼簿物件,在qtp中,可以通過vb中的clipboard物件來訪問剪貼簿物件,設定或獲取剪貼簿的資料。
剪貼簿只能同時容納一組同一型別的資料,當新的資料存入剪貼簿時,原有的資料將會被替換。
(1)、clipboard物件的方法
clear:用於清空clipboard中的資料
getdata:用於獲取clipboard中的資料
getformat:用於檢查clipboard中的資料格式
gettext:用於獲取clipboard中的文字資料
setdata:用於向clipboard設定資料
settext:用於向clipboard設定文字資料
(2)、clipboard物件的使用
set clipboard = createobject("mercury.clipboard") '建立clipboard物件
clipboard.clear '清空原有資料
clipboard.settext str,format(可選) '預設為vbcftext,format引數在vbs中不適用 clipboard.settext 「text」 '設定剪貼簿資料,類似於ctrl+c,
clipboard. gettext(format)(可選),引數在vbs中不適用
msgbox clipboard. gettext '獲取剪貼簿資料,類似於ctrl+v,format, set clipboard=nothing'釋放物件
QTP對link物件的雙擊操作
儘管link物件的雙擊操作對於實際的網頁瀏覽行為而言產生,但是最近還是碰到了需要對link物件做雙擊的自動化測試。首先根據link.click的舉一反三我猜測雙擊操作可以如下表示link.dblclick,表面上看是正確的,因為對於部分物件的確有這樣的寫法,如winedit,dialog等。但是試下...
qtp 常用對用及後面所跟的操作
獲取30天免費使用期 1 在 c programdata safenet sentinel刪除或更改名稱 2 qtp右鍵屬性 開啟位置 找到 instdemo.exe 雙擊執行 1 webedit 文字框 set 資料 2 weblist 下拉列表框 select 資料 3 image 影象 cli...
QTP專題 04 物件及操作方法
本節介紹知識點包括 1.qtp自動化的原理 2.兩類物件 to 測試物件 ro 執行物件 3.操作方法 settoproperty,getroproperty,gettoproperty 1.封裝被測物件到物件庫 2.執行應用,對比物件庫里的物件屬性和執行時的真實被測物件的屬性 3.對比一致後找到相...